I am working on my daughters 98 explorer with the 4.0 sohc engine and 24700 miles,sometimes the rpm will drop to around 400 rpm them back up to 550rpm. It will do this 3 times then die if you dont give it the gas. I am thinking its the TPS but my question is what is the normal rpm in gear. Thanks for any advice.

IAC valve is worn out. Replace it, don't bother to clean it, there is nothing to be cleaned inside.

I replaced the IAC 2 months ago, at that time it would not idle at all when cold.
 






Check MAF and IAC. To check IAC let the engine idle and unplug it while its idling. it should completely die. If no change at all then it is prob bad. Also since you just replaced it take some starter fluid and spray around the iac to make sure it got a good seal and is not sucking in any air. Do the same all around the motor to check for vacuum leaks it may have a leak somewhere. Is there any codes? Also have you checked the fuel pressure?
 






IAC valves from parts store, OE from dealer or junk yard are very different animals.
